In the case of Palau, the foundations of women’s safety, as measured through the baseline dimensions (Equity, Protection, Resources) of the Women’s Safety Index (WSI), increased 6 index points, from 65 in 1995 to 71 in 2024.

Dimensions

The Resources dimension has increased over 1999-2015, suggesting steady improvement in the institutions and structures that support women’s safety.
